Standing out for the breadth of its services, Cescon Barrieu‘s offshore, shipping and maritime team is seen with great regularity advising on high-end financing transactions and regulatory issues. Dry shipping contractual matters, including shipbuilding and charter agreements, are core areas of activity for the firm, which is also skilled in assisting offshore drilling contractors in deals with shipyards and oil companies. The multidisciplinary team, which is able to call upon the firm’s strong network of corporate, tax and litigation practitioners, is led by the ’hands-on, commercial and solution-oriented‘ Rafael Baleroni. Baleroni specialises in project finance, M&A and restructurings, with a special focus on the infrastructure sector.

Work highlights

  • Advised Bourbon Offshore on its business combination with MLOG group.
  • Represents DOF Group in lawsuits against Petrobras regarding maritime torts and contractual matters.
  • Acts for Log-in in a lawsuit before the Federal Supreme Court involving the construction project of the Porto das Lajes, a terminal that is intended to be built near the meeting of the rivers Negro and Solimões in the Amazon rainforest.
